The document discusses the Volocopter, an electric vertical take-off and landing aircraft developed by German company e-volo. It has 18 rotors and is powered entirely by electricity, making it more efficient and eco-friendly than gas-powered helicopters. A two-seater prototype demonstrated flight in 2016. The Volocopter is designed for passenger transport and has applications for air taxis, rescue operations, and agriculture. It aims to make air travel safer, simpler and cleaner through its fully electric design.

• At Volocopter we are building the first manned, fully electric and safe VTOLs in the world. We
want to make humanity’s dream of flying come true and help modern cities resolve
increasing mobility issue .
• The initial two-seat design uses battery packs, with a flight-time duration of only about 20 to
30 minutes. It will be certified for sport flying, Zosel says, and he plans to sell the copters for
about $340,000. He's also working to develop a hybrid power system that would extend flight
time to over one hour. But that's just the beginning of Zosel's vision. "The aim is to change
the mobility for a lot of people, not only for fun," he says. "For transportation, and for getting
work done."
• The flying machine looks something like a helicopter but it is quite different and is intended
to be a future answer to the greening of noisy, vibration-heavy helicopters as we have known
them. A two-seater prototype of the Volocopter, by the company e-volo, made its maiden
voyage earlier Karlsruhe, Germany
7. Design and development
• The Volocopter is an entirely new aircraft
with many rotors and a lot of new ideas.
DG Flugzeugbau is a key partner of the
development network and responsible for
the development and construction of
composite structures.
• The e-volo VC200 Volocopter is a single-
place
experimental electric multirotor helicopter.
• The single-place, 18 motor, all-electric e-
volo VC1 "Volocopter" was demonstrated
on 21 October 2011.
• The VC2 is the next follow-on with 18
engines suspended around an aluminum
truss frame that includes a center-mounted
seat, battery, and Battery Management
Unit.
• Two prototypes performed unmanned flight
tests, with the first manned flight made on
March 30, 2016 by Alexander Zosel.

10. SUPREME SAFETY
• The Volocopter 2X incorporates superior design systems in all critical areas assuring the
highest degree of reliability. This encompasses propellers, electric motors, battery packs,
electronics, displays and much more. In addition, all communication networks are connected
via the latest optical fibers - in other words “fly-by-light”. There are also numerous support
systems for flight control and stabilization. Also on board, although you will never require it,
is an emergency parachute.
11. OPERATING SO SIMPLE
• Flight has never been so easy. Only a short induction is required to operate the
Volocopter. The reason: The latest support systems and more than 100
microprocessors automatically ensure perfect stability and control of the
multicopter. Whether it is altitude control, balance or landing, the Volocopter 2X
can easily and intuitively be operated by a single joystick. Even if the pilot lets go of
the joystick, the multicopter will retain its prevailing position fully automatically.
Even better, in areas in which autonomous operations are possible, it can simply
fly on its own.
12. COST EFFECTIVE
• The Volocopter 2X sets new benchmarks not just in terms of reliability and
simplicity, but also where cost effectiveness is concerned. Fuel is replaced by
economic (and increasingly sustainably generated) electricity. On top of this,
requirements for maintenance, repair and overhaul are reduced to a minimum
through the avoidance of complex mechanical components. The simple and
intuitive operation also does away with the need for an extra pilot. The Volocopter
just flies by itself.
